JUDGING FORM

We believe our team deserves a GOLD medal because we met the following criteria



Requirements for a Bronze Medal:

Register the team, have a great summer, and plan to have fun at the Regional Jamboree.

Successfully complete and submit this iGEM 2011 Judging form.

Create and share a Description of the team's project using the iGEM wiki and the team's parts using the Registry of Standard Biological Parts.

Plan to present a Poster and Talk at the iGEM Jamboree.

Enter information detailing at least one new standard BioBrick Part or Device in the Registry of Standard Biological Parts.

Part Number(s): BBa_K526000, BBa_K526001,BBa_K526002

Submit DNA for at least one new BioBrick Part or Device to the Registry.

Part Number(s): BBa_K526000, BBa_K526001,BBa_K526002



Requirements for a Silver Medal:

Demonstrate that at least one new BioBrick Part or Device of your own design and construction works as expected; characterize the operation of your new part/device.

Part Number(s): BBa_K526000, ,BBa_K526002

Enter this information and other documentation on the part's 'Main Page' section of the Registry
Part Number(s): BBa_K526000, ,BBa_K526002



Requirements for a Gold Medal:

Improve an existing BioBrick Part or Device and enter this information back on the Experience Page of the Registry.

Part Number(s): BBa_K592000, ,BBa_K508107

Help another iGEM team by, for example, characterizing a part, debugging a construct, or modeling or simulating their system.

Outline and detail a new approach to an issue of Human Practice in synthetic biology as it relates to your project, such as safety, security, ethics, or ownership, sharing, and innovation.
